Where does the money in my money pot come from?
Short answer: From two sources: the margins you set on products, credited on every sale on the shop, and the payments you make yourself by card or bank transfer.
Margins
This is the main source. On a shop with margins, you set an amount for each product that is added to its price. Every time that product sells on the shop, the amount is credited to your money pot, less the transaction fees.
This credit is a royalty DAGOBA pays your organization in return for the use of its logo on the items sold. Its amount equals the margin you set.
Every credit of this kind is itemised in the list: the shop, the buyer, the order number and the item sold. So you can trace a euro back to the order that produced it.
Your own payments
You can also pay money into the pot yourself, by card or bank transfer. That is what to do when an order is held up for lack of funds to cover a coupon. Such a payment is an advance payment against your future purchases from DAGOBA.
What empties it
Debits come from gift cards you issue, from coupons at the moment they pay for an order, from bank withdrawals, and from the transaction fees charged on the 1st of each month.
